Government Bids & Contracts

Learning about existing government bids and contracts can be a difficult undertaking. There are established organizations and sites that assist businesses with discovering these bids. Below are a few and you can find additional services by searching online. Please note: the business sites below charge fees for their services and are not in any way endorsed by WorkForce One.

  • GovernmentBids.com opened its site July 1, 1998 to assist other small business owners seeking to win state and local procurement opportunities. Based in Atlanta, Georgia, GovernmentBids.com is now a leading online government bid and RFP listing services. The site currently has listings from local, state and federal agencies.   • The Small Business Exchange Inc., established in 1984, is a business information resource for small Asian, Black, Hispanic woman and disabled veteran-owned businesses. the Small Business Exchange (SBE) provides accurate, up-to-date information about contract opportunities in the public and private marketplaces.
